Wagering Requirements and Bonus Terms Explained
Understanding wagering requirements is crucial for evaluating any bonus offer. Simply put, this term refers to the number of times you must play through the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it) before you can withdraw any winnings.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a £100 bonus means you need to place bets totalling £3,000 before the funds become withdrawable.
Not all games contribute equally to these requ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, meaning every pound wagered counts fully. Table games like blackjack and roulette often contribute only 10% to 20%, while video poker may contribute even less. This disparity means that if you prefer table games, you will need to wager significantly more to clear the bonus. Some casinos also exclude certain games entirely, so always check the terms before playing.

The key takeaway is that lower wagering requirements are always more player-friendly. A 25x requirement is significantly better than 45x, especially if you are playing games with lower house edges. When comparing bonuses, always prioritise offers with lower playthrough rates, as they give you a realistic chance of converting bonus funds into real money.

Maximum Bet Limits and Bonus Restrictions
When playing with an active bonus, Jupiter Club imposes maximum bet limits to prevent players from clearing wagering requirements too quickly. The standard limit is usually £5 per spin or hand, though this can vary depending on the promotion. If you place a bet exceeding this limit while bonus funds are active, the casino may void your bonus and any associated winnings.
These restrictions apply to all games, including slots, table games, and live dealer options. Some promotions also restrict betting patterns, such as covering multiple numbers on a roulette wheel or using progressive betting systems like Martingale. The purpose is to ensure that bonuses are used for entertainment rather than as a guaranteed profit mechanism. Violating these rules, even unintentionally, can result in the loss of your bonus balance.
